How will you distinguish between 1 3 pentadiene and 1/4 pentadiene on the basis of UV spectroscopy?
The compounds can be distinguished via UV spectroscopy by measuring their value. 1,3-pentadiene is a type of conjugated compound while 1,4-pentadiene is not conjugated. This causes the of 1,3-pentadiene to be higher than 1,4-pentadiene allowing us to distinguish between both.

Which is more stable 1/4-pentadiene or 1/3 butadiene and why?
1,4-Pentadiene has molecular structure CH2=CH-CH2-CH=CH2. It has only unconjugated bonds. Thus it forms less resonant structures. As 1,3-butadiene has more resonance structures, it is more stable than 1,4-pentadiene.

3,3-Dimethylpentane is one of the isomers of heptane. 3,3-Dimethylpentane has a boiling point of 86.0 °C and melting point of −134.9 °C. Its density is 0.6934. The refractive index is 1.39092 at 20 °C.

What functional group is C6H10?
alkene
Structure of Cyclohexene Its chemical formula is C6 H10. It is a six-membered carbon ring with a double bond in between two of the carbon atoms. When an organic compound has a carbon-carbon double bond we call it an alkene. This is the functional group of the molecule.
